Where Should I go: Amman or Hobart?

Amman

Amman is the largest city in of the Hashemite Kingdom of the country of Jordan. It is also the capital city of Jordan and has a population of over four million people. Many people use Amman as a base for venturing out into the rest of Jordan and other surrounding countries. There are many things to see and do in Amman.

Hobart

Hobart is the capital city of the Australian island state of Tasmania. It is small compared to the mainland's larger cities and has a cooler climate with four distinct seasons. Hobart is also the second oldest capital, behind Sydney, with remnants of its past visible in old sandstone warehouses now home to cafes and galleries, as well as a historic district with narrow lanes and colonial-era cottages.

Which place is cheaper, Hobart or Amman?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.

The average daily cost (per person) in Amman is $135, while the average daily cost in Hobart is $156.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Amman and Hobart in more detail.



Accommodation
  • Accommodation Hotel or hostel for one person
    Amman $49
    Hobart $77
  • Accommodation Typical double-occupancy room
    Amman $98
    Hobart $154

When is the best time to visit Amman or Hobart?

Hobart has a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, but Amman experiences a warm climate with fairly sunny weather most of the year.

Should I visit Amman or Hobart in the Summer?

The summer attracts plenty of travelers to both Amman and Hobart. Warm weather and sunshine bring visitors to Amman year-round. Also, the summer months attract visitors to Hobart because of the hiking and the family-friendly experiences.

Amman is a little warmer than Hobart in the summer. The daily temperature in Amman averages around 25°C (77°F) in July, and Hobart fluctuates around 17°C (63°F)in January.

People are often attracted to the plentiful sunshine in Hobart this time of the year. In Amman, it's very sunny this time of the year. Amman usually receives more sunshine than Hobart during summer. Amman gets 364 hours of sunny skies, while Hobart receives 259 hours of full sun in the summer.

In July, Amman usually receives less rain than Hobartin January. Amman gets 10 mm (0.4 in) of rain, while Hobart receives 41 mm (1.6 in) of rain each month for the summer.


  • Summer Average Temperatures July and January
    Amman 25°C (77°F) 
    Hobart 17°C (63°F)

Typical Weather for Hobart and Amman

Amman Hobart
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 8°C (46°F) 149 mm (5.9 in) 17°C (63°F) 41 mm (1.6 in)
Feb 9°C (48°F) 98 mm (3.9 in) 18°C (64°F) 39 mm (1.5 in)
Mar 12°C (54°F) 62 mm (2.4 in) 16°C (61°F) 45 mm (1.8 in)
Apr 16°C (61°F) 23 mm (0.9 in) 14°C (57°F) 44 mm (1.7 in)
May 21°C (70°F) 3 mm (0.1 in) 11°C (52°F) 46 mm (1.8 in)
Jun 24°C (75°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 9°C (48°F) 37 mm (1.5 in)
Jul 25°C (77°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 9°C (47°F) 60 mm (2.4 in)
Aug 25°C (77°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 10°C (49°F) 60 mm (2.4 in)
Sep 24°C (75°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 11°C (52°F) 50 mm (2 in)
Oct 20°C (68°F) 26 mm (1 in) 13°C (55°F) 58 mm (2.3 in)
Nov 14°C (57°F) 68 mm (2.7 in) 14°C (58°F) 53 mm (2.1 in)
Dec 10°C (50°F) 138 mm (5.4 in) 16°C (60°F) 54 mm (2.1 in)
